SFPUC reported CleanPowerSF serves about 81,000 accounts with low opt-out rates and plans July auto-enrollment to expand to ~105,000 accounts; the commission approved a $14,030,000, three-year amendment with Calpine Energy Solutions for customer and administrative services.

Barbara Hale, assistant general manager for power, updated the commission on CleanPowerSF enrollment and regulatory activity. The program serves approximately 81,000 accounts with a 3.2% opt-out rate (retaining roughly 96.8% of enrolled customers).
